A Wanderer of the Baroque: The Life and Legacy of Bernhard Keil

Bernhard Keil, known to history by the evocative pseudonym Monsù Bernardo, was a painter whose life traced a magnificent arc across the most vibrant artistic centers of seventeenth-century Europe. Born in 1624 in the coastal town of Helsingør, Denmark, Keil was a figure of profound international character, blending Northern European precision with the dramatic grandeur of the Italian Baroque. His early years were shaped by the disciplined traditions of his homeland, where he studied under the Danish master Morten Steenwinkel. This foundational training instilled in him a meticulous eye for detail and a reverence for realistic depiction that would remain a hallmark of his brushwork, even as his stylistic horizons expanded far beyond the borders of Denmark. The trajectory of Keil’s career took a monumental turn when, driven by ambition and perhaps the pull of the great artistic currents of the age, he arrived in Amsterdam. Between 1642 and 1644, Keil secured a place within the legendary workshop of Rembrandt van Rijn. This period of apprenticeship was nothing short of transformative; immersed in the atmosphere of Rembrandt’s studio, Keil absorbed the mastery of chiaroscuro, learning how to manipulate light and shadow to evoke deep psychological resonance and dramatic tension. His time in the Netherlands was further enriched by his association with Jan Lievens and his work with the influential art dealer Hendrick Uylenburgh. During these formative years, Keil moved from being a student of technique to an artist of independent vision, eventually managing his own workshop in Amsterdam before the siren call of the South beckoned him toward Italy.

The Roman Transformation and Artistic Maturity

In 1656, Keil embarked on a journey that would irrevocably alter his artistic soul: a pilgrimage to Rome. This transition from the moody, light-drenched interiors of the Dutch tradition to the sun-soaked, monumental splendor of the Italian Baroque allowed him to synthesize his diverse influences into a singular style. In Italy, he became known as Monsù Bernardo, a name that suggests the charming familiarity with which he was embraced by the local artistic community. His work began to reflect the grandeur of the Vatican and the vibrant energy of the Roman streets, yet it never lost the intimate, observational quality he had inherited from his Northern training. As his reputation grew, Keil’s reach extended into the territories of Venice and Bergamo, where he applied his skills to a variety of genres. While he was capable of producing sacred altarpieces and dignified portraits, it was in his genre paintings—scenes of everyday life, often imbued with a sense of narrative movement and character—that his true genius flourished. He possessed a rare ability to elevate the mundane, turning simple rural scenes or domestic encounters into profound meditations on the human condition. His influence was not merely a matter of personal achievement but also one of artistic lineage; he became a precursor and inspiration for later masters such as Salvator Rosa and Antonio Amorosi, leaving an indelible mark on the evolution of Italian genre painting.

A Lasting Impression on European Art

The historical significance of Bernhard Keil lies in his role as a bridge between disparate artistic worlds. He was a true cosmopolitan, a painter who could navigate the somber, introspective depths of the Dutch Golden Age and the theatrical, exuberant heights of the Italian Baroque with equal grace. His life serves as a testament to the interconnectedness of the seventeenth-century art market, where ideas, techniques, and artists flowed freely across borders, defying national boundaries. To look upon a work by Keil is to witness a dialogue between North and South. One can see the ghost of Rembrandt in the way light clings to a subject's face, yet one also feels the warmth and classical aspiration of the Roman tradition. His legacy is found not only in the canvases that survive but in the way he helped shape the very language of European painting, proving that an artist’s true home is not found in a single geography, but in the universal pursuit of beauty and truth.
  • Early Training: Studied under Morten Steenwinkel in Denmark.
  • The Rembrandt Connection: Apprenticeship in Amsterdam (1642–1644).
  • Italian Period: Settled in Rome from 1656 until his death in 1687.
  • Key Influences: Rembrandt van Rijn, Jan Lievens, and the Italian Baroque masters.
  • Artistic Legacy: Influenced painters like Pietro Bellotti and Antonio Cifrondi.
